How they compare

Samoa currently reports 3 t against 0 t in Guadeloupe, a difference of 3 t.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 26 shared years of data; in 1978 it was Guadeloupe ahead.

Guadeloupe ranks 200th and Samoa ranks 198th of 210 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Guadeloupe averaged higher in 3 and Samoa in 2.

The Fertilizers by Nutrient dataset contains information on the totals in nutrients for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ers. The data are provided for the three primary plant nutrients: nitrogen (N), phosphorus (expressed as P2O5) and potassium (expressed as K2O).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
